Abstract

The application provides a method and device for determining a lighting scheme, and relates to the technical field of intelligent dimming. The method comprises the following steps: lighting and photographing a first detection target according to N alternative lighting schemes to obtain N lighting images corresponding to the N alternative lighting schemes respectively, wherein the N alternative lighting schemes are obtained by adjusting lighting parameters of a light source according to a preset adjustment rule; performing character recognition on the N lighting images through a deep learning model to obtain character recognition results of the N alternative lighting schemes; and determining a lighting scheme for the first detection target from the N alternative lighting schemes according to the character recognition results of the N alternative lighting schemes, wherein N is a positive integer. The method can objectively select a suitable lighting scheme according to the character recognition results, thereby reducing the influence of artificial subjective judgment when determining the lighting scheme, improving the quality of the lighting scheme, and further improving the character recognition accuracy of a product image.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of intelligent dimming, in particular to a method and device for determining a lighting scheme. BACKGROUND

[0002] With the development of science and technology, the production scale of industrial products is increasingly expanding. Before the industrial products are shipped, the products need to be detected to obtain image information of the product surface, and the character information on the product surface is representative. Whether the machine can accurately identify the character information on the product surface mainly depends on whether the lighting scheme adopted for the product when the image is obtained is appropriate. If the lighting scheme is appropriate, the identification result is more accurate. However, the commonly used lighting method at present is to manually adjust the lighting parameters by a person to determine the lighting scheme. Therefore, the selected lighting scheme is greatly affected by the subjective judgment of the operator, which may result in poor accuracy of the character recognition on the product surface. Moreover, the judgment standards of different operators are different, and it is difficult to determine a relatively objective lighting scheme. In addition, the lighting is inefficient only by manual operation.

[0003] Therefore, when selecting the lighting scheme, how to reduce the influence of the subjective judgment of the person and improve the quality of the lighting scheme, and further improve the character recognition accuracy of the product image, is an urgent problem to be solved. SUMMARY

[0117] Figure 1 is a schematic diagram of a character recognition system 100 suitable for embodiments of the present application.

[0118] A character recognition system suitable for embodiments of the present application comprises a light source control system, an imaging system and a computing device. The computing device can be connected to the light source control system and the imaging system.

[0119] The light source control system comprises one or more light sources, each of which has at least one adjustable lighting parameter, such as the direction of emitted light, wavelength, brightness, color temperature, etc. The light source control system is used to adjust the lighting parameters of each light source according to a preset adjustment rule to obtain N alternative lighting schemes, where N is a positive integer. In embodiments of the present application, the preset adjustment rule can be to obtain different lighting parameter combinations by step adjustment of the parameters, thereby obtaining different alternative lighting schemes. However, the preset adjustment rule in the present application is not limited to the step-by-step method, and other methods can also be used, such as the fixed value setting method (i.e. using a fixed parameter combination), the function operation method (i.e. determining the lighting parameter combination according to a specific function relationship), the interval setting method (i.e. different settings can be used for different intervals, such as using the fixed value setting method in the first interval and the step-by-step method in the second interval), the reference reasoning method (i.e. reasoning the adjustment of the lighting parameters based on the reference of known lighting schemes to obtain new alternative lighting schemes), as long as the automatic adjustment of the alternative lighting schemes can be achieved.

[0120] In one embodiment, the light source control system includes one light source, the lighting parameter includes the emission light direction and the brightness, and the emission light direction is represented by the horizontal angle and the pitch angle. The adjustable range of the horizontal angle is [-30, 30], the adjustable range of the pitch angle is [-30, 30], the unit is degree, the single adjustable angle value is 30 degrees (i.e. the adjustment step is 30 degrees), the negative angle means the emission light is left-biased, and the positive angle means the emission light is right-biased. The brightness is directly represented by the brightness value, the adjustable range of the brightness is [6000, 10000], the unit is nit, and the single adjustable brightness is 2000 nit. Therefore, the preset adjustment rule proposed in the application can be to adjust the above lighting parameters in turn, and to combine each lighting parameter and its different values. Therefore, based on the above example, the following 27 alternative lighting schemes can be obtained at most:

[0121] Emission light direction: (-30, -30), brightness: 6000; emission light direction: (0, -30), brightness: 6000; emission light direction: (30, -30), brightness: 6000; emission light direction: (-30, 0), brightness: 6000; emission light direction: (0, 0), brightness: 6000; emission light direction: (30, 0), brightness: 6000; emission light direction: (-30, 30), brightness: 6000; emission light direction: (0, 30), brightness: 6000; emission light direction: (30, 30), brightness: 6000;

[0122] Emission light direction: (-30, -30), brightness: 8000; emission light direction: (0, -30), brightness: 8000; emission light direction: (30, -30), brightness: 8000; emission light direction: (-30, 0), brightness: 8000; emission light direction: (0, 0), brightness: 8000; emission light direction: (30, 0), brightness: 8000; emission light direction: (-30, 30), brightness: 8000; emission light direction: (0, 30), brightness: 8000; emission light direction: (30, 30), brightness: 8000;

[0123] Emission light direction: (-30, -30), brightness: 10000; emission light direction: (0, -30), brightness: 10000; emission light direction: (30, -30), brightness: 10000; emission light direction: (-30, 0), brightness: 10000; emission light direction: (0, 0), brightness: 10000; emission light direction: (30, 0), brightness: 10000; emission light direction: (-30, 30), brightness: 10000; emission light direction: (0, 30), brightness: 10000; emission light direction: (30, 30), brightness: 10000.

[0125] In some possible embodiments, the above-mentioned light source control system includes two modes: a recommended mode and a full scheme mode. Among them, the alternative lighting scheme determined in the recommended mode is the alternative lighting scheme that is used more frequently in the light source control system. For example, the following alternative lighting schemes in the above-mentioned embodiments:

[0126] Emitting light direction: (-30, 0), brightness: 8000; Emitting light direction: (0, 0), brightness: 8000; Emitting light direction: (0, 30), brightness: 8000;

[0127] Emitting light direction: (-30, 0), brightness: 8000; Emitting light direction: (0, 0), brightness: 8000; Emitting light direction: (0, 30), brightness: 8000;

[0128] Emitting light direction: (-30, 0), brightness: 10000; Emitting light direction: (0, 0), brightness: 10000; Emitting light direction: (0, 30), brightness: 10000;

[0129] And the full scheme mode is to adjust each lighting parameter in each light source in turn and combine them to determine all alternative lighting schemes that the current light source control system can combine, for example, all alternative lighting schemes in the above-mentioned embodiments.

[0130] As can be seen, although the full scheme mode needs to determine a selected lighting scheme from a large number of alternative lighting schemes, the time-consuming of determining the lighting scheme is longer than that of the recommended mode, but the accuracy of the finally determined lighting scheme is the highest. Although the recommended mode determines the lighting scheme faster, the number of alternative lighting schemes for comparison is limited, and the quality of the finally determined lighting scheme may not be as high as that of the lighting scheme in the full scheme mode. Therefore, the full scheme mode can be applied to the case where the light source control system determines the lighting scheme for the first time, and the recommended mode can be applied to the case where the light source control system determines the lighting scheme for the first time.

[0131] An imaging system includes one or more cameras that synchronously capture the target when the light source control system lights the target, obtaining N lighting images.

[0132] In some possible embodiments, the frequency of the imaging system needs to be equal to or greater than the frequency of the light source control system changing the lighting scheme, so as to ensure that at least one lighting image corresponds to each lighting scheme.

[0133] In order to reduce the load of image processing of the system, the imaging system records the interval between the time stamps of the light source control system changing the lighting scheme, and runs simultaneously with the light source control system to ensure time synchronization. When the imaging system takes multiple lighting images between two time stamps, the system will retain the lighting image with higher brightness among the lighting images.

[0134] In some possible embodiments, the imaging system described above includes multiple cameras, which respectively take the target under lighting according to different shooting angles, or different focal lengths, etc. Among them, different cameras in the same time stamp jointly take multiple lighting images of the target under the same lighting scheme. The imaging system can first perform the above image selection processing on the images taken by each camera, and retain the lighting image with higher brightness in the time stamp of each camera. The selected lighting images can be spliced into one lighting image. Therefore, one lighting scheme corresponds to one lighting image, whether the lighting image includes one picture or multiple spliced pictures.

[0135] It should be understood that when the imaging system includes only one camera, one lighting image includes only one picture. When the imaging system includes multiple cameras, one lighting image includes multiple spliced pictures.

[0136] The computing device includes a processor, a memory, a communication interface, a transmitter, and a receiver. It has computing capability and can be used to send indication information to the light source control system and the imaging system, instructing the light source control system to generate a lighting scheme and light the target, and instructing the imaging system to take pictures, etc. The computing device can also be used to receive N lighting images from the imaging system.

[0137] In some possible embodiments, the computing device described above can be a server. The server can be a local server or a cloud server, and the embodiments of the present application do not limit this.

[0138] In some possible embodiments, the processor described above can be a central processing unit (CPU) or a graphics processing unit (GPU), etc. The processor described above can be used to pre-process the obtained lighting images; can also be used to perform character recognition on the lighting images according to a deep learning model; and can also be used to score N alternative lighting schemes corresponding to N lighting images, and select the finally selected lighting scheme. It should be understood that the character recognition result output by the character recognition on the lighting image corresponding to the finally selected lighting scheme is also relatively accurate.

[0139] In some possible embodiments, the memory described above can be a random access memory (RAM) or a non-volatile memory (NVM), etc. The memory described above can be used to store data required by the processor in the calculation process; can also be used to store the character recognition result of the processor, etc.; and can also be used to save the lighting scheme, the lighting image, and the score thereof, etc.

[0140] In some possible embodiments, the communication interface is configured to communicate with other devices, such as user devices such as displays, keyboards, etc. The processor, the memory, and the communication interface described above communicate through a bus. The bus can include a data bus, a power bus, a control bus, and a status signal bus, etc.

[0141] In some possible embodiments, the receiver and the transmitter can be configured to receive information or data from other devices or systems, etc. The receiver can be configured to receive the lighting image from the imaging system, or can be configured to receive the lighting image from the device for controlling the imaging system; and the transmitter can be configured to send the lighting scheme or the indication information to the light source control system, or can be configured to send the lighting scheme or the indication information to the device for controlling the light source control system.

[0142] Based on the system provided above, the embodiment of the present application provides a method for determining a lighting scheme.

[0143] Figure 2 is a method flow diagram for determining a lighting scheme provided by the embodiment of the present application.

[0144] S210: According to N alternative lighting schemes, the first detection target is respectively lighted and photographed to obtain N lighting images respectively corresponding to the N alternative lighting schemes.

[0145] The N alternative lighting schemes are obtained by adjusting the lighting parameters of the light source according to a preset adjustment rule. The preset adjustment rule can refer to the corresponding description in the foregoing embodiments. The lighting parameters include at least one of the following adjustable parameters: the direction of emitted light, the wavelength, the brightness, the color temperature, and the number of light sources.

[0146] It should be understood that the light source used for lighting the target can be composed of multiple sub-light sources. Therefore, the number of light sources can be used as a lighting parameter.

[0147] Those skilled in the art can clearly understand that, for the convenience and brevity of description, the specific working process of obtaining N alternative lighting schemes and obtaining N lighting images can refer to the corresponding process in the foregoing embodiments, which will not be described herein.

[0148] S220: Perform character recognition on the N lighted images by the deep learning model to obtain character recognition results of the N alternative light schemes.

[0149] In some possible embodiments, the deep learning model described above can be an OCR model. Perform character recognition on each of the N lighted images by the OCR model to obtain character recognition results of the N alternative light schemes.

[0150] S230: Determine the light scheme for the first detection target from the N alternative light schemes according to the character recognition results of the N alternative light schemes.

[0151] It should be understood that the character recognition result of the finally determined light scheme for the first detection target is clearer and more accurate than the character recognition results of other alternative light schemes. Therefore, the finally output character recognition result is also relatively accurate.

[0152] Based on the technical solution described above, by automatically adjusting the light parameters of the light source, determining available alternative light schemes, performing character recognition on the lighted images obtained based on each light scheme respectively, and according to the character recognition results, an alternative light scheme that is relatively suitable can be objectively selected from the multiple alternative light schemes, thereby reducing the influence of artificial subjective judgment when determining the light scheme, improving the quality of the light scheme, and further improving the character recognition accuracy and efficiency of the product image. Meanwhile, the adjustment of the alternative light scheme can be automatically performed without the need for manual adjustment based on experience, thereby improving the selection efficiency and providing a more suitable light scheme.

[0153] Specifically, when character detection needs to be performed on a certain type of detection target (e.g., characters on a wafer, a circuit board, or a mechanical device), different types of detection targets can be suitable for different light schemes. In a traditional scheme, a limited number of alternative light schemes need to be set by artificial experience, and then it is determined one by one whether they are suitable for the current detection target. However, this method is not only low in efficiency, but also cannot guarantee that the most suitable light scheme is selected. The embodiments of the present application automate the entire process including the obtaining of alternative light schemes, the acquisition of lighted images, the character recognition of lighted images, and the selection of light schemes, which can greatly reduce the influence of artificial subjective judgment in the setting and selection process of the light scheme, and can provide a more suitable light scheme, thereby improving the character recognition accuracy of the product image.

[0154] In some possible embodiments, before performing character recognition on the N lighted images by the deep learning model respectively, the obtained lighted images can also be subjected to image preprocessing, which includes image flipping, image rotation, Gaussian filtering, erosion and expansion, and the like.

[0155] Based on the technical solution, the accuracy of character recognition of the lighted image can be effectively improved, and the lighted image is more easily recognized.

[0156] In addition, when the lighted image is clear enough or easy to recognize characters, the lighted image can be directly recognized, without the image preprocessing operation.

[0157] In some possible embodiments, based on S230, the embodiment of the present application further provides another method for determining a light scheme.

[0158] Figure 3 is a flowchart of another method for determining a light scheme provided by the embodiment of the present application.

[0159] S310: For each lighted image, determine the minimum bounding rectangle position, the minimum bounding rectangle area and the confidence of each character in the lighted image, and determine the score of the lighted image according to the minimum bounding rectangle position, the minimum bounding rectangle area and the confidence of each character in the lighted image.

[0160] In some possible embodiments, the minimum bounding rectangle position, the minimum bounding rectangle area and the confidence of each character in the lighted image can be determined by the OCR model, and the first score corresponding to each lighted image can be determined according to the minimum bounding rectangle position, the minimum bounding rectangle area and the confidence of each character in the lighted image. The first score can be the score of the lighted image, and the confidence of each character can be a deep network inference confidence.

[0161] It should be understood that, in addition to the OCR model, the deep learning model can also be other deep learning models capable of recognizing the minimum bounding rectangle position, the minimum bounding rectangle area and the confidence of characters, and the embodiment of the present application does not limit this.

[0162] S320: Determine the light scheme corresponding to the lighted image with the highest score as the light scheme for the first detection target.

[0163] It should be understood that when the score is the first score, the light quality of the light scheme corresponding to the highest first score is the best, so that each character recognized based on the light scheme is the clearest, and further, the character recognition result is the relatively most accurate character recognition result.

[0164] Based on the technical scheme, the minimum circumscribed rectangle position, the minimum circumscribed rectangle area and the confidence of each character in the lighted image are used to determine the first score, and the current lighted scheme is objectively evaluated according to the first score. Since the standard of the first score is objective and unified, the subjective factors caused by manual evaluation are reduced, the quality of the lighted scheme is improved, and the character recognition accuracy of the product lighted image is improved.

[0165] As can be seen from the above description of the embodiments, the first score can be determined by the minimum circumscribed rectangle position, the minimum circumscribed rectangle area and the confidence of each character in the lighted image. Therefore, the embodiments of the present application further provide a method for determining the first score.

[0166] Figure 4 A flowchart of a method for determining the first score provided by the embodiments of the present application is shown.

[0167] S410: According to the position of the minimum circumscribed rectangle of each character in the lighted image, a clustering model is used to determine J character region blocks in the lighted image, wherein each character region block includes I characters.

[0168] Wherein, I and J are positive integers.

[0169] In some possible embodiments, the clustering model is mainly used to divide a larger character region into J local parts, and the I characters in each local part are mutually adjacent or similar characters. By performing character recognition on each local part, the accuracy of character recognition can be effectively improved. The clustering model applied to the embodiments of the present application can include a K-means clustering algorithm, a system clustering algorithm, etc.

[0170] It should be understood that when there is only one character in the lighted image, the lighted image can also be subjected to a clustering operation first, and the result after the clustering operation is that the lighted image has only one local part, and the local part has only one character.

[0171] S420: According to the confidence of each character in each character region block, a character confidence average value of each character region block of the lighted image is determined.

[0172] In some possible embodiments, the character confidence average value of the character region block of the lighted image can be determined according to the following formula (1):

[0174] Wherein, represents the confidence of the i-th character in the j-th character region block, avgp jrepresents the average value of the character confidence of the jth character region block, j is a positive integer less than or equal to J, and i is a positive integer less than or equal to I.

[0175] It should be understood that the average value of the character confidence obtained by the above formula (1) is the average value of the character confidence corresponding to a character region block in an illuminated image. Since there are J character region blocks in an illuminated image, an illuminated image should correspond to J average values of the character confidence, and each average value of the character confidence is calculated by averaging the confidence of I characters.

[0176] In an embodiment, the above-mentioned confidence can be determined by a neural network model based on deep learning, and ranges from 0 to 1. The closer to 1, the greater the probability that the model judges that the character belongs to the specified category.

[0177] For example, there are 10 illuminated images, and each illuminated image has only one number, 0-9. At this time, the pictures can be divided into Char0-Char9, a total of 10 categories, and the illuminated images are labeled with their corresponding labels. Then each picture is input into a neural network classifier for training. During the training process, the parameters in the neural network model are automatically adjusted so that the final output of the neural network model is consistent with the labeled label. At this point, the neural network model has learned how to recognize the 10 categories of numbers 0-9.

[0178] However, in fact, the recognition result output by the neural network model may not be completely consistent, so the output of the neural network model may be as follows:

[0179] The probability of classifying the current picture as Char0 is 0.25, the probability of classifying as Char1 is 0.57; the probability of classifying as Char2 is 0.12; the probability of classifying as Char3 is 0.24; the probability of classifying as Char4 is 0.54; the probability of classifying as Char5 is 0.14; the probability of classifying as Char6 is 0.28; the probability of classifying as Char7 is 0.58; the probability of classifying as Char8 is 0.99; and the probability of classifying as Char9 is 0.05.

[0180] At this time, the classification Char8 with the highest probability, which corresponds to the number 8, can be taken as the recognition result of the character, and the confidence is 0.99, and the character confidence is obtained.

[0181] S430: Determine the average value of the character bounding box area of each character region block of the illuminated image according to the minimum bounding box area of each character in each character region block.

[0185] Similar to the determination of the average value of the character confidence, the average value of the character circumscribed rectangle area is the average value of the character circumscribed rectangle area corresponding to a character region block in a lighted image. Since there are J character region blocks in a lighted image, a lighted image should correspond to J average values of the character circumscribed rectangle area, and each average value of the character circumscribed rectangle area is calculated by averaging the minimum circumscribed rectangle areas of I characters.

[0186] S440: determining a first character region block of the lighted image according to the average value of the character confidence and the average value of the character circumscribed rectangle area of the lighted image.

[0187] In some possible embodiments, the first character region block of the lighted image can be determined by the standard deviation of the character confidence in each character region block of the lighted image and the standard deviation of the character circumscribed rectangle area in each character region block: determining the standard deviation of the character confidence and the standard deviation of the character circumscribed rectangle area of each character region block of the J character region blocks according to the average value of the character confidence and the average value of the character circumscribed rectangle area of the lighted image; determining the character region block with the minimum sum of the standard deviation of the character confidence and the standard deviation of the character circumscribed rectangle area as the first character region block.

[0188] Taking the j-th character region block as an example, the standard deviation of the character confidence in the j-th character region block can be determined according to the following formula (3):

[0194] It should be understood that the area of the minimum bounding rectangle between each character in the first character region block is the most average, and the character confidence between each character is the closest.

[0195] S450: Determine the first score according to the average value of the character confidence and the average value of the character bounding rectangle area corresponding to the first character region block of the lighted image.

[0196] In some possible embodiments, the above-mentioned first score mainly includes two parts. The first part has a positive correlation with the average value of the character confidence of the first character region block of the lighted image. That is, the greater the average value of the character confidence of the first character region block of the lighted image, the higher the overall confidence of the recognized character, and the greater the value of the first part. The second part has a negative correlation with the standard deviation of the average value of the character bounding rectangle area of the first character region block of the lighted image. That is, the greater the standard deviation of the average value of the character bounding rectangle area of the first character region block of the lighted image, the more irregular the recognized character, and the smaller the value of the second part. Adding the two parts can represent that the higher the above-mentioned first score when the string of characters is more regular and the confidence is higher.

[0197] In some possible embodiments, other constants or variables can be introduced into the above-mentioned first score to expand the score factors considered when determining the above-mentioned first score.

[0198] It should be understood that the second part of the above-mentioned first score can represent whether the recognized character size is uniform and regular, which mainly includes two cases:

[0199] The first case is that the recognized character size is not uniform and regular due to defects in the lighted scheme. At this time, even if the average value of the character confidence corresponding to the recognized character is high, since the size of the recognized character is not uniform and regular, the above-mentioned first score is lowered, so it cannot become the highest score among the N first scores determined.

[0200] The second case is that the character distribution in the lighted image is not uniform and neat by itself, but the characters in each character region in the obtained lighted image can be incomplete due to defects in the lighted scheme. Because the characters are incomplete, the average value of the character bounding rectangle area of the character region is relatively close, which further leads to the standard deviation of the character bounding rectangle area close to 0. However, the average value of the character confidence determined in this case will be very low, which will lower the first score as a whole, and it cannot become the highest score compared with other determined first scores. For a better lighted scheme, because the character distribution is not uniform and neat by itself, even if the standard deviation of the character bounding rectangle area of the character region is large, it usually does not lower the first score too much.

[0201] Based on the above technical solution, the first score corresponding to the candidate lighted scheme can be objectively and uniformly determined by the above method, and then a more appropriate lighted scheme can be selected, which reduces the influence of artificial subjective judgment in determining the lighted scheme, selects a suitable lighted scheme as the target lighted scheme, improves the quality of the lighted scheme, and further improves the character recognition accuracy of the product image.

[0202] In some possible embodiments, for the scene of selecting a lighted scheme for the first detection target, the lighted scheme corresponding to the highest first score can be determined as the finally selected lighted scheme for the first detection target. Because the lighted scheme is a relatively general lighted scheme, when the second detection target is lighted, the second detection target can also be lighted and photographed according to the lighted scheme for the first detection target to obtain a lighted image of the second detection target, and the subsequent character recognition process is performed.

[0203] However, even if the determined lighted scheme for the first detection target is selected to light the second detection target, after obtaining the lighted image of the second detection target, the lighted image still needs to be subjected to the above scoring operation to determine the first score. When the first score is higher than the first preset threshold, the lighted scheme for the first detection target is used to light the second detection target, and the character recognition result is output.

[0204] The first preset threshold is a positive number, which can be 1.0, 1.2, or other reasonable thresholds.

[0205] It should be understood that when the first detection target and the second detection target are the same or similar products, the lighting scheme determined for the first detection target can generally be used. However, when the first detection target and the second detection target are different in type and have a large difference in structure, the lighting scheme for the first detection target cannot be used. At this time, the first score of the lighting scheme determined for the second detection target can be lower than the first preset threshold, so the lighting parameters need to be adjusted, the N candidate lighting schemes are determined again, and the steps of S210-S230, S310-S320, S410-S450 are performed again to determine the appropriate lighting scheme for the second detection target.

[0206] Based on the above technical solution, since the determined lighting scheme for the first detection target is a relatively general scheme, when the first detection target is first lighted, if the differences between other detection targets and the first detection target are not large, the previously determined lighting scheme for the first detection target can also be applied to the lighting operation of other detection targets, thereby improving the efficiency of character recognition on the surfaces of different products. Even if the differences between the first detection target and other detection targets are large, the lighting scheme can be automatically determined again to reduce the manual participation in subsequent light adjustment operations, further improve the quality of the lighting scheme, and further improve the character recognition accuracy and efficiency of the product image.

[0207] In some possible embodiments, when the lighting scheme for the first detection target is determined, the lighting scheme and the first detection target information can be stored in the local or server. For the detection target subjected to subsequent lighting, the finally determined lighting scheme thereof can also be stored in the local or server.

[0208] Taking lighting of the second detection target as an example, before the second detection target is lighted, information of the second detection target can be determined first, and it is checked whether the determined lighting scheme for the second detection target is stored, that is, whether the second detection target is a historical target.

[0209] If the checking succeeds, the found lighting scheme is directly used for the lighting operation of the second detection target, and character recognition is performed on the lighted image.

[0210] If the checking fails, the lighting scheme finally used for the last lighting target is used.

[0211] For example, the last time the light target is the first detection target, the light scheme for the first detection target is determined, so the light scheme for the first detection target is used first to light the second detection target, and the first score of the light picture corresponding to the light scheme is determined. If the first score at this time is not higher than the first preset threshold, the light parameter is adjusted, the N alternative light schemes are determined again, and the steps of S210-S230, S310-S320, S410-S450 are performed again to determine the light scheme of the second detection target, and finally the light scheme for the second detection target is determined.

[0212] Based on the above technical solution, the light scheme determined in the history can be stored, and when the light operation is performed on the historical target again, the light scheme corresponding to the historical target can be called to perform the light operation, so that the light scheme is optimal for the target, and the repeated determination of the light scheme is avoided, the efficiency of determining the light scheme is improved, and the efficiency of character recognition on the surface of the product is further improved.

[0213] Based on the above embodiment, the present embodiment provides another method for determining a light scheme: a second score and a third score are introduced, and the scores are determined together with the first score to determine the highest score corresponding to the alternative light scheme as the light scheme for the first detection target, so that the finally determined light scheme is more suitable and the light quality is higher.

[0214] Figure 5 A flowchart of another method for determining a light scheme provided by an embodiment of the present application is shown.

[0215] S510: determining a second score according to the length of the first real string and the length of the character recognition result of the alternative light scheme.

[0216] The first real string is the real character information of the surface of the first detection target.

[0217] In some possible embodiments, the second score can be determined by comparing the difference between the length of the first real string of the light image and the length of the character recognition result of the alternative light scheme. For example, the second score can be determined according to the following formula (5):

[0227] S520: Determine a third score according to the similarity between the first real string and the character recognition result of the alternative lighting scheme.

[0228] In some possible embodiments, the third score can be determined according to the edit distance between the first real string and the character recognition result of the alternative lighting scheme.

[0229] It should be understood that the edit distance refers to the minimum number of editing operations for converting the character recognition result into the first real string, and the editing operation can include inserting a character at any position, deleting a character at any position, and modifying a character at any position. In the embodiments of the present application, the higher the similarity between the first real string and the character recognition result, the smaller the edit distance, and the higher the third score, for example, closer to 1.

[0230] Alternatively, the third score can also be determined according to the cosine similarity between the first real string and the character recognition result of the alternative lighting scheme.

[0231] It should be understood that the cosine similarity measures the similarity between two vectors by measuring the cosine value of the included angle between the two vectors. The cosine value of a 0-degree angle is 1, the cosine value of any other angle is not greater than 1, and the minimum value is -1. Thus, according to the cosine value of the angle between two vectors, it can be determined whether the two vectors point in substantially the same direction. When the two vectors have the same direction, the value of the cosine similarity is 1; when the two vectors have an included angle of 90°, the value of the cosine similarity is 0; and when the two vectors point in completely opposite directions, the value of the cosine similarity is -1. In the embodiments of the present application, the higher the similarity between the first real string and the character recognition result, the higher the cosine similarity between the first real string and the character recognition result, and the higher the third score, for example, closer to 1.

[0232] Alternatively, the third score can also be determined according to the Euclidean distance between the first real string and the character recognition result of the alternative lighting scheme.

[0233] It should be understood that the Euclidean distance is a distance measure that measures the absolute distance between points in a multi-dimensional space, wherein the distance measure is used to measure the distance between individuals in space, and the farther the distance, the greater the difference between individuals. In the embodiments of the present application, the higher the similarity between the first real string and the character recognition result, the smaller the Euclidean distance between the first real string and the character recognition result, and the higher the third score, for example, closer to 1.

[0234] S530: Determine the above score according to the first score, the second score, and the third score.

[0235] In some possible embodiments, the above score is a weighted sum of the above first score, the above second score, and the above third score.

[0236] In some possible embodiments, the above first score, the above second score, and the above third score can be weighted by preset weights λ1, λ2, and λ3, respectively. The preset weights can be pre-set or directly modified in subsequent processes, and the embodiments of the present application do not limit this. And λ1, λ2, and λ3 can satisfy the following condition: λ1+λ2+λ3=1. Further, the value range of λ1 can be [0.5, 0.8], the value range of λ2 can be [0.1, 0.25], and the value range of λ3 can be [0.1, 0.25].

[0237] S540: When the score is the current highest score, determine that the alternative lighting scheme corresponding to the highest score is the current lighting scheme for the first detection target.

[0238] Based on the above technical scheme, when the first real string is known, the second score and the third score are introduced to determine the score together with the first score, so that the determined lighting scheme for the first detection target is more objective and reasonable, and the output character recognition result is more accurate.

[0239] In some possible embodiments, for the scene of selecting a lighting scheme for the first detection target, the lighting scheme corresponding to the highest score can be determined as the final selected lighting scheme for the first detection target. Since the lighting scheme is a relatively general lighting scheme, when the second detection target is lighted, the second detection target can also be lighted according to the lighting scheme for the first detection target, and a lighted image of the second detection target is obtained by photographing, and a subsequent character recognition process is performed.

[0240] However, even if the determined lighting scheme for the first detection target is selected to light the second detection target, after obtaining the lighted image of the second detection target, the lighted image still needs to be subjected to the above scoring operation to determine the score. When the score is higher than the second preset threshold, the lighting scheme for the first detection target is used to light the second detection target, and a character recognition result is output.

[0241] The second preset threshold is a positive number, which can be a reasonable threshold value such as 1.25, 1.5, etc.
